如何在安装插件时自动将插件短代码插入模板文件
答案 0 :(得分:1)
您可以通过操作挂钩执行短代码。看起来appthemes提供了许多here
查看div中是否有要显示短代码的动作挂钩。
此示例将在帖子后执行您的短代码。
<?php
function my_awesome_shortcode() {
echo do_shortcode('[name_of_shortcode]');
}
add_action( 'appthemes_after_post', 'my_awesome_shortcode' );
?>
答案 1 :(得分:0)
试试这个: 将此代码放在插件主文件中。
/* This function runs when plugin is activated */
function myplugin_activate() {
add_shortcode( 'footag', 'footag_func' );
}
register_activation_hook( __FILE__, 'myplugin_activate' );
/* Function to register shortcode */
function footag_func( $atts ) {
return "foo = {$atts['foo']}";
}